Solis Tractors expands mid-range portfolio with launch of Solis JP 975

Solis Tractors has strengthened its presence in the competitive 48–50 HP category with the rollout of the Solis JP 975, a new mid-range model engineered for the demands of modern farming. With a refreshed design and upgraded performance package, the Solis JP 975 targets farmers seeking a durable, fuel-efficient, and versatile tractor capable of handling intensive fieldwork and commercial applications.

At the core of the new model is a 48 HP engine designed to deliver consistent power across a wide range of agricultural tasks. The tractor features an advanced hydraulic system for smoother implement operations, while fuel-efficient engineering helps reduce operating costs—an increasingly important consideration for farm enterprises striving to maximize profitability.

Operator comfort receives notable attention in the JP 975. The tractor’s ergonomically reworked platform includes a fully flat, rubber-matted deck, a cushioned and adjustable driver seat with backrest support, and an improved steering wheel designed for better grip and maneuverability during long working hours. These refinements aim to reduce fatigue and enhance productivity in the field.

The JP 975 is built for durability, with a rugged structure capable of withstanding harsh field conditions. Performance upgrades include a seven-stage cooling system that supports continuous high-load operations and a smart shuttle system that enables quick directional shifts for tasks requiring frequent forward–reverse transitions. Safety features such as a compact fitted bumper add protection without compromising the design aesthetic.

Solis has positioned the tractor as a versatile workhorse by equipping it with a ladder chassis suited for loader and dozer applications, broadening its utility across diverse farming and commercial environments. Early impressions from the on-ground launch highlight the model’s strong build, responsive handling, and competitive feature set, reinforcing Solis’ commitment to innovation and farmer-centric engineering.

The debut of the Solis JP 975 adds momentum to the company’s strategy of offering robust, high-value tractors in key horsepower segments.
